Ingredients
2 chicken breasts (substitute with 1 block tofu for vegetarian option)
2 tbsp cajun
2 tbsp paprika
2 tbsp mixed herbs
salt, to taste
pepper, to taste
1 garlic clove, minced
20g butter
1 small cauliflower, cut into small bite-sized florets
150g bacon, chopped
½ cup mushrooms, sliced
½ cup cherry tomatoes, halved
1 cup spinach
1 tbsp coriander, finely chopped (optional)
Sauce:
40g butter
3 tbsp flour
2 cups chicken broth (substitute with vegetable broth for vegetarian option)
½ cup heavy cream
½ cup parmesan cheese, grated
Preparation
Step 1
Preheat the oven to 190°C fan bake.
Step 2
Heat the butter in a large pan over medium heat. Once the butter is foaming, add the cauliflower and bacon. Stir occasionally, and let cook for 5 minutes. Add the mushrooms and cook until they’re lightly golden. Add the spinach and cherry tomatoes to the pan and stir continuously until wilted (roughly 1 minute). Add salt and pepper to taste. Remove from the heat, and set aside in a bowl.
Step 3
In a small bowl, mix together the cajun, paprika, mixed herbs, salt, pepper, and garlic. Coat the chicken breasts in the spice mixture. Heat pan over medium-high heat, cook the chicken until golden brown.
Step 4
Sauce: In a separate pan/pot, add the butter and allow it to melt over low-medium heat. Add the flour and stir until combined. Use a whisk if there are lumps. While mixing, add 1/4 of the chicken broth (it will thicken quickly). Then gradually add remaining broth, stirring as you go. Add the cream, and allow to simmer for a minute. Then add the grated parmesan cheese. The sauce should reach a slightly thick consistency.
Step 5
Add the sauce to the chicken, and then add the cauliflower, bacon, mushroom, spinach, and cherry tomato mix. Add more salt and pepper to taste. Transfer the mixture to a baking dish, and top with grated parmesan. Bake for 20 minutes, or until the cheese is golden. Then serve with fresh coriander (optional).
